SECTION FOUR - Effects DefinitionsCompressor/Limiter - A compressor is used to constrain the dynamics of an instrument. In other words,it sets a bound

Noise Gate - A Noise Gate keeps unwanted noise from being heard when you are not playing. When the gateis closed, it will not allow ambient noise to c
